Default Ran Fine Last Night, Wont Start This Morning

I have a 1989 E-150 Van Club Wagon XLT. Its got the 302 in it with the ambulance package.

I just drove back home about 300 miles last night and everything was fine. Parked it, went to sleep, got up today, went out to start it just a few minutes ago, turns over fine but doesn't start - doesn't even try. Its getting fuel but no fire. I have checked all the fuses inside and out, no problems there. Starter is working as is the battery, so thats not the issue. When I turn the key from Off to Run, I do hear a relay click.

I bought this van a couple of weeks ago, its run really well and has started very easily every time for me until now. The only thing different about today is it has rained all day. I talked to the previous owner, he said there has never been any starting problems, wet or not.

Before I tear the coil out and have it tested, any ideas on what else I should check? I know on my Chevy van the ICM went out but it always started and ran, it would just die after it warmed up and then would not restart. But it always started when cold. Should I bother tearing out the ICM and having it tested?

Does this van have a low oil cutoff switch? I am about a quart low, I just noticed that today but I am going to change it tomorrow anyway, so I plan to wait to take care of that.
